Here's the Google translation into English ( for those of us who are monolingual..)
In the matter of this 69 COPO 9561 Camaro 9N634XXX I knew this COPO Camaro was in Montreal at the beginning of the Nineties. I saw it sometimes at gatherings of street racers in Lafleur in the east of Montreal, It had the rear panel painted black, but it was already restored at that time. According to the VIN it is one of the first COPOs sold in Canada. A little later by accident I spoke with the owner, it was sold, but he still had a copy of the GM Canada documentation, I recall just which several code Z had. I remember seeing a Montreal Dealer's logo on the rear, but I do not remember any more of not. I think that it was Harold Cummings but I am not sure. Or this:
My question is that if this COPO Camaro were restored in the middle of the Eighties, it was not easy to find references to COPO Camaros in magazines at that time. It only can be restored from original photos. I also remember a guy who had a 69 427 Chevelle at that time Montreal, which was said to be original, il fesait rire de lui. But I remember that it looked like a COPO with an SS Hood but no SS emblems. Today I think that it was a COPO. (I can't figure out, "il fesait rire de lui") -Sam
